M.Ø.B. Will Be In Columbus – Rock on the Range!

We are getting excited here at M.Ø.B. as we will be heading to Columbus, Ohio this coming weekend for Rock on the Range. We have already lined up to record with Adelitas Way, Anthrax, Aranda, Bobaflex, Eve to Adam,Ghosts of August and James Durbin. We also have a few others in the works that we are waiting to get final confirmations from. Check back next week for updates as well as we hope to post from the festival as well!!

From Huffington Post: Bully: Has a Timeless Issue Found Its Moment?

Check out this article by Lee Hirsch who is a director, producer, cinematographer, and writer and was the director for the movie Bully.

Almost everyone has a story. That moment when we were bullied, or that entire school year, has stayed with us for a lifetime. Acutely memorable. Painfully timeless. Every year, the U.S. Dept. of Education estimates 13 million American kids are bullied. If you extrapolate that number, year after year, decade after decade, that means hundreds of millions of people.

I am often asked, is bullying getting worse? Or are we just talking about it more? There are no easy answers.
